By popular request, here is a maintenance log from the time I bought the vehicle. Those entries marked with a * are ones that I actually have a written record of (usually a receipt from a service station). The others are mostly repairs that I have made myself, and I entered these either by my own notes or from memory, usually with approximate figures. Date Miles Description ------------------------------------------------------------------------- 4/26/2000 170,786 Calif. State Inspection * 5/25/2000 170,844 Vehicle purchased in San Mateo, CA. New belts, spark plugs, filters * 7/2000 172,000 Installed CD/Radio and Speakers, floor mats, cupholder, re-soldered rear defogger. 8/04/2000 173,271 New tires * 9/2000 173,400 Oil Change 5/31/2001 174,923 20-point inspection at dealership, Oil Change * 7/2001 178,500 Air Filter, O2 sensor, muffler bandage, Mud flaps, Oil Change, gas cap 8/2001 180,500 Alternator 9/2001 181,500 Oil Change 12/17/2001 182,658 Front disk brakes and master cylinder * 3/2002 183,300 Fuel filter, spark plugs 5/08/2002 183,712 Calif. State Inspection * 12/2002 185,000 Oil Change, tail light 3/2003 186,000 Thermostat, radiator cap, windshield fluid pump 9/2003 189,000 Oil Change 9/12/2003 190,203 Transmission - Rear Seal 10/2004 190,700 Battery and terminals, distributor cap and rotor, spark plugs, wires, air/fuel filters, new muffler, bandaged tailpipe, paint touchup. 11/12/2004 190,799 NJ State Inspection * 4/01/2005 191,500 Starter 5/2005 192,000 Ignition coil, aux. air valve, air flow meter 9/2005 192,500 Oil change 4/12/2006 193,223 Rear Brake Drums, replace 1 tire * 5/2006 193,265 Air intake coupler, Fuel Pressure Regulator, Headlight 7/2006 193,290 Computer, turn signal 8/2006 193,300 Replace another tire, Replace starter again (under warranty). 9/2006 193,350 Found and fixed the main EFI relay problem. 10/2006 193,400 Blower motor. 11/2006 193,500 Failed inspection. Replaced windshield (not easy to find!) and tail light to pass. 12/2006 193,700 Left-rear power window motor. 3/2007 194,500 Cressida wrecked. Stripped of parts and sold for scrap Updated 6/30/2007
